From 0000000000000000000000000000000000000000 Mon Sep 17 00:00:00 2001
From: Samuel Maddock <smaddock@slack-corp.com>
Date: Tue, 12 Nov 2024 17:30:42 -0500
Subject: refactor: unfilter unresponsive events
RendererUnresponsive events are filtered out when
* DisableHangMonitor switch is set
* WebContents is awaiting a clipboard scan
* Any remote debugger is attached
* Any local debugger is attached
* Visibility state is not visible
* Renderer process is not initialized
This CL removes these filters so the unresponsive event can still be
accessed from our JS event. The filtering is moved into Electron's code.
